On a class field trip, one student out of a class of 24 is needed to assist the zookeeper in feeding the elephant. Explain how to use a random number generator to choose the student assistant fairly.

Step 1
Determine the range of numbers that the random number generator should produce. In this case, the range should be from 1 to 24, since there are 24 students in the class. Show more…
